Bridey
BRY-dee
Bridey is a girl’s name of Irish origin, meaning “A diminutive form of Bridget, meaning 'exalted one, strength'.”, and peaked in popularity in 1971.

The Story of Bridey
This diminutive name once charmed parents in the early 1970s, a sweet echo of a powerful goddess.
Bridey is a tender diminutive form of Bridget, the name of the revered Celtic goddess of poetry, healing, and smithcraft. Its roots lie in the Old Irish word 'brigh,' meaning strength or power, softened into a more intimate address.
